Trace, which Marshall do you prefer from the reissues to have your Jose installed and also PPMV? 50 or 100 watt? HW or PCB?

As far as performing the work there is not one that is any easier than another and they all sound very similar to one another but if you want that little extra something (IE: the x-factor) then the 1959HW would be the way to go. I hear and feel a difference but please keep in mind that for most this is splitting hairs.

Master Volume:
The HG-Jose Mod comes with a Master Volume so there is not a need for a PPIMV. Note: The PPIMV does not work well with the HG-Jose Mod and therefore it is not recommended.

If you had to pick one for yourself which one would you take?

If budget and wattage are not a concern I would go with the 1959HW series. If they are a concern then any 1987/1959 model will work as will any JCM800 2204/2203.
